Energy Efficiency
Chest freezers use a little more space than upright freezers, however they consume less energy to run. They're also generally slightly less expensive to purchase at first.
Both freezer types can aid in reducing trips to the supermarket and also help to cook meals in batches for the entire family. But a chest freezer offers [visit this hyperlink] more space, so it is ideal for those who wish to store produce or meats for later, or make homemade smoothies, as well as other snacks.
The sidewall insulation of a chest freezer helps it to keep food frozen for a longer duration. It consumes a minimal amount of electricity. They also have a lower noise level than upright freezers, especially when they are situated in a remote location.
The upright freezers require a process of defrost that consumes a lot of energy and consumes space. They also don't have the capacity to keep things frozen for as long if there is an issue with power.
If you're putting the freezer in an area that can get hot, like garages, be sure to read the instructions provided by the manufacturer for storage and ensure it has the right insulation. You'll need to ensure that the freezer has enough space above it that you are able to lift the lid with ease and you also have an electric outlet nearby.
